Subject: [for-next][PATCH 0/7] tools/rtla: Updates for v6.18
Date: Tue, 30 Sep 2025 17:46:30 -0400	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20250930214630.332381812@kernel.org> (raw)

  git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/trace/linux-trace.git
tools/for-next

Head SHA1: 05b7e10687c69e0c28e62b9a74ce78b3e7463806


Costa Shulyupin (1):
      tools/rtla: Consolidate common parameters into shared structure

Crystal Wood (6):
      tools/rtla: Move top/hist params into common struct
      tools/rtla: Create common_apply_config()
      tools/rtla: Consolidate code between osnoise/timerlat and hist/top
      tools/rtla: Fix -A option name in test comment
      tools/rtla: Add test engine support for unexpected output
      tools/rtla: Add remaining support for osnoise actions
